Land Grading in Houston, TX

Land grading services involve shaping and leveling the surface of a property to ensure proper drainage, stability, and a solid foundation for future construction or landscaping projects. These services are commonly requested for new home builds, driveway installations, yard renovations, and landscaping improvements, helping property owners create a safe and functional outdoor space. Before requesting land grading, property owners should consider the current slope of the land, drainage issues, and the desired final grade to prevent water pooling, erosion, or foundation problems.

Understanding the scope of land grading is essential for homeowners planning to improve their property. It's important to evaluate existing terrain features, soil conditions, and any nearby structures that may influence grading plans. Clear communication about project goals and concerns can help ensure the work achieves the intended results, providing a stable base for landscaping, drainage systems, or construction projects. Proper land grading can enhance both the safety and usability of outdoor spaces for years to come.

Project Types

Common Land Grading Jobs

Land grading - reshapes the land surface to improve drainage and prevent erosion.

Yard leveling - creates a flat, even surface for lawns, gardens, or outdoor structures.

Drainage correction - directs water flow away from foundations and low-lying areas.

Slope installation - ensures proper runoff and reduces standing water on property.

Site preparation - prepares land for construction, landscaping, or new landscaping features.

Erosion control grading - stabilizes slopes and prevents soil loss during heavy rains.

FAQ

Land Grading Questions

What is land grading? Land grading involves shaping the soil surface to ensure proper drainage and a level foundation for construction or landscaping projects.

Why is land grading important for property owners? Proper grading prevents water pooling, reduces erosion, and creates a stable base for building or landscaping improvements.

What types of projects typically require land grading? Projects such as building foundations, driveways, lawns, and drainage systems often need land grading to prepare the terrain.

How does land grading impact drainage on a property? It directs water away from structures and prevents flooding by creating a slope that guides runoff effectively.
